Sinopsis
Brought to the Table is a podcast made by friends who like to enjoy things andlearn about things together. As a group they discuss a wide range of topics thatcover fields of science, engineering, music, video games, and other neat stuff.Diana Schulberg, Ian Walker, Carter VanHuss, Kaitlyn Phillips, and Scott Pruetthave known each other for years and are still finding new things that they cantalk about and learn about together.
